Output 19d7e084dacefafcfd698514105f6f50226d7fcf0695f3aa735631749731a551:18

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 defb22beb22b885565103ba43b88fb48afb6c23a
address
tb1qmmaj904j9wy92egs8wjrhz8mfzhmds36n9mh0x
transaction
19d7e084dacefafcfd698514105f6f50226d7fcf0695f3aa735631749731a551
confirmations
21002
spent
true